You can see the air crush a can in this experiment. For this experiment you will need: an empty aluminum soft-drink can a 2- or 3-liter (2- or 3-quart) saucepan a pair of kitchen tongs Fill the saucepan with cold water. Put 15 milliliters (1 tablespoon) of water into the empty soft-drink can. Heat the can on the kitchen stove to boil the water.

When the water in the can is heated to boiling, the can fills with hot air and steam. As long as the can is open to the atmosphere, the gas pressure inside the can is the same as atmospheric pressure. When the can is inverted and …
What is different in the experiment is that none of the variables (temperature, volume, pressure, or number of particles) are actually held constant throughout the experiment. In this case, identifying a simple relationship between two variables is impossible. In other words, the can crushing cannot be explained by simply stating ...
